程序员啊,程序员,究竟是咋的

10-12-01 lqtcts
其实,我很早就想说这些话,今天又看了一下公司的烂代码,我疯狂了!!!

现在程序员真悲哀啊,代码不知道咋写的,都跟你分了三层架构了,各个层次

代码混乱,啥逻辑往Action里塞,都几千行代码了,还塞个毛啊 。

相比较service层的,我靠,都没什么业务。当中的一层被架空了!

再看DAO层,我靠,sql语句写的死死的,啥变量直接写成字符串。

一个date类new他妈一百多次,你就不知道写在一个地方复用一下

啊,我操,真猪脑! slq语句拼装真稀烂,完全不像程序员,靠

思路都不清晰,写个鸟的代码,这代码拿出去不笑死人的。我真的无语

了,都写了这么长时间代码的人了,写出来的代码,真是稀烂,惨不忍赌

实在看不下去了!啊......

    

9
shawnxue
2010-12-02 10:25
确实有这种普遍情况,反映了公司管理很差

SpeedVan
2010-12-02 10:36
从你的语言中,我强烈感受到你的愤怒了。

设计和架构,一直是国内所忽略的地方,没办法。现在能重新重视起来是好事。以前大干sql主宰的程序就一堆了,那时就发觉,咋不像软件了,像个数据库加了个壳似的,整个软件变了味儿。整天谈业务业务,而业务实现工作就像翻译似地,完全就是翻译成数据库增删改。还有面向功能,写过程的方式实现功能,一般软件就算了,系统也这样干,我就纳闷了,这系统怎么读?

我一直觉得计算机软件专业缺少了这些教育,导致出来的人看到的,都是算法,感觉OO是空有一谈似的。其实OO最实在的地方,就像设计和架构等思想,而不是实现。

oojdon
2010-12-03 12:40
是不是二八原则在这里也适用?

80%的忽悠 + 20%的技术 = 中国软件公司

jdkbean
2010-12-04 12:58
急功近利是一个主观原因。

但一些客观原因也使企业不得已而为之。

猜你喜欢
6Go 1 2 3 4 ... 6 下一页